Sec. 958. Annual reports to Congress; contents

    (a) Within one hundred and twenty days following the convening of 
each session of Congress the Secretary shall submit through the 
President to the Congress and to the Office of Science and Technology an 
annual report upon the subject matter of this chapter, the progress 
concerning the achievement of its purposes, the needs and requirements 
in the field of coal or other mine health and safety, the amount and 
status of each loan made pursuant to this chapter, a description and the 
anticipated cost of each project and program he has undertaken under 
sections 861(b) and 951 of this title, and any other relevant 
information, including any recommendations he deems appropriate.
    (b) Repealed. Pub. L. 96-470, title I, Sec. 106(f), Oct. 19, 1980, 
94 Stat. 2238.

(Pub. L. 91-173, title V, Sec. 511, Dec. 30, 1969, 83 Stat. 803; Pub. L. 
95-164, title III, Sec. 303(f), Nov. 9, 1977, 91 Stat. 1321; Pub. L. 96-
470, title I, Sec. 106(f), Oct. 19, 1980, 94 Stat. 2238.)


                               Amendments

    1980--Subsec. (b). Pub. L. 96-470 struck out subsec. (b) which 
provided that within 120 days following the convening of each session of 
Congress, the Secretary of Health, Education, and Welfare submit through 
the President to the Congress and to the Office of Science and 
Technology an annual report on health matters covered by this chapter.
    1977--Subsecs. (a), (b). Pub. L. 95-164 inserted references to mines 
other than coal mines.


                    Effective Date of 1977 Amendment

    Amendment by Pub. L. 95-164 effective 120 days after Nov. 9, 1977, 
except as otherwise provided, see section 307 of Pub. L. 95-164, set out 
as a note under section 801 of this title.


                  Termination of Reporting Requirements

    For termination, effective May 15, 2000, of provisions in subsec. 
(a) of this section relating to requirement to submit annual report to 
Congress, see section 3003 of Pub. L. 104-66, as amended, set out as a 
note under section 1113 of Title 31, Money and Finance, and page 124 of 
House Document No. 103-7.

                          Transfer of Functions

    Functions vested by law in Office of Science and Technology and in 
Director or Deputy Director of Office of Science and Technology 
transferred to Director of National Science Foundation, and Office of 
Science and Technology, including offices of Director and Deputy 
Director, provided for by sections 1 and 2 of Reorg. Plan No. 2 of 1962, 
eff. June 8, 1962, 27 F.R. 5419, 76 Stat. 1253, was abolished by 
sections 2 and 3(a)(5) of Reorg. Plan No. 1 of 1973, eff. July 1, 1973, 
38 F.R. 9579, 87 Stat. 1089, set out in the Appendix to Title 5, 
Government Organization and Employees.
